The Pittsburgh Steelers released undrafted rookie Trevon Mason yesterday. Mason was signed to the team after being invited to rookie mini camp in the May. Now they're apparently looking to sign a pass rusher from the free agent market to fill that roster spot.

According to ESPN's Jeremy Fowler the Steelers are working out Wyatt Ray, Ifeadi Odenigbo, and Trent Harris.

Ray spent last season with the Cincinnati Bengals, and the year before that with the Tennessee Titans. He bounced around a few practice squads prior to that after coming into the league as an undrafted free agent with the Cleveland Browns. He has 3 career sacks.

Odenigbo is a name some might recognize. He spent last season with the Browns and played in only 9 games. In 2020 he had his best season as a pro starting 15 games for the Minnesota Vikings. He has 10.5 career sacks. He was a 7th round pick by the Vikings in 2017.

Harris was an undrafted free agent signee of the New England Patriots back in 2018. He spent the past two seasons with the New York Giants but only appeared in 8 games over two seasons.
